Harper’s years as a trauma nurse in New York City have left her worn out and questioning everything. Seeking solace, she retreats to Sapphire Bay to live with her beloved grandfather, hoping to mend both her heart and mind.
In the quiet beauty of her hometown, Harper reconnects with Owen, her best friend’s brother and a former police officer carrying scars of his own. Together, they form a bond built on understanding, empathy, and shared struggles.
As Harper and Owen navigate the challenges of their pasts, their connection grows stronger, guiding them toward healing, hope, and the promise of a fresh start in a community that feels like home.
